Water pressure repair services involve diagnosing and fixing issues related to inconsistent or inadequate water flow within a plumbing system. Skilled service providers assess the overall water pressure, identify the root causes of pressure problems, and implement solutions to restore optimal flow. This process may include repairing or replacing faulty pressure regulators, fixing leaks, clearing blockages, or addressing pipe corrosion that can impact water flow. Proper water pressure is essential for the efficient operation of fixtures and appliances, making timely repairs important to prevent further plumbing issues.
Water pressure problems can lead to a variety of inconveniences and potential property damage. Low water pressure may result in weak water flow from faucets, showers, and appliances, making daily tasks more difficult. Conversely, excessively high water pressure can cause stress on pipes and fixtures, increasing the risk of leaks, bursts, or damage to plumbing components. Repair services help resolve these issues, ensuring consistent water flow and preventing costly repairs or water waste caused by pressure fluctuations.

The overview below groups typical Water Pressure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in American Fork, UT.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Service Costs - Water pressure repair services typically range from $150 to $500, depending on the extent of the issue and the necessary repairs. For example, minor pressure adjustments may cost around $150, while more complex repairs could reach $500 or more.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for water pressure repair generally fall between $75 and $200 per hour. The total cost depends on the complexity of the repair and the local rates of service providers in the area.
Material Fees - Replacement parts such as pressure regulators or valves usually cost between $50 and $200. The overall cost varies based on the specific components needed for the repair.
Additional Costs - Additional charges may include diagnostic fees or service call fees, which can range from $50 to $150. These fees are often separate from the cost of parts and labor for the repair itself.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
